Alexis Sánchez will be sidelined for up to a week after suffering a thigh injury in warmups during the Super Cup on Wednesday. The injury is minor though he will probably miss the Gamper Cup (if it is played due to strike). Pep Guardiola had planned to start Alexis on Wednesday after his performance on [...]

A last ditch effort on Friday afternoon by Spanish Professional Footballers’ Union (AFE) and the Liga de Futbol Profesional (LFP) to reach an agreement over unpaid wages and avoid a players strike failed resulting in the first week of La Liga being postponed. This is fourth strike since the league began back in 1929 with [...]

FC Barcelona defeated Real Madrid 3-2 at home this evening, 5-4 on aggregate to secure the Spanish Super Cup for a third consecutive year. The match was hard fought as both sides battled back and forth for 90 plus minutes. Of course any Barcelona, Real Madrid match is not complete without controversy and this was [...]

Today at 1pm local time Cesc Fabregas was unveiled at the Camp Nou infront of tens of thousands. He walked on to the pitch wearing number 4 and gave the fans a glimpse of what is in store for the 2011/2012 season.

Well the saga of Cesc Fabregas and FC Barcelona is finally OVER!! Thursday evening Arsenal agreed to let Fabregas out of his contract and approved the transfer to Barcelona. However the official announcement was delayed due to Arsenal not giving approval in written form until Sunday. Fabregas deal reportedly consists of Arsenal receiving £29.8 million [...]
